Leveraging User-Generated Content for Authenticity

In an era of increasing skepticism towards traditional advertising, authenticity is more valuable than ever. Consumers are more likely to trust recommendations from their peers than from brands themselves. This is why user-generated content (UGC) has become such a powerful marketing tool. UGC encompasses any form of content created by users, such as reviews, testimonials, photos, videos, and social media posts. By encouraging your customers to share their experiences with your brand, you can tap into a wealth of authentic content that builds trust and credibility. The concept rings true to the ethos of vincispin: empower the audience to shape the narrative. This approach not only provides social proof but also fosters a sense of community around your brand. The challenge lies in curating and showcasing this content effectively, ensuring that it aligns with your brand’s values and messaging.

Building a UGC Strategy

Creating a successful UGC strategy requires a proactive approach. Start by identifying the types of content that are most relevant to your brand and your target audience. Then, develop a clear call to action, encouraging your customers to share their experiences. This could involve running a contest, creating a branded hashtag, or simply asking for reviews. It's important to make it easy for customers to submit their content and to acknowledge their contributions. Actively monitor social media channels and other online platforms for mentions of your brand and respond to comments and feedback. Remember to obtain permission before using any user-generated content in your marketing materials. Ultimately, a successful UGC strategy is one that fosters a genuine connection with your customers and empowers them to become brand advocates.

Key Performance Indicators (KPIs) for Narrative Marketing

Identifying the right KPIs is crucial for measuring the success of your narrative marketing efforts. Some key metrics to track include: brand awareness (measured through social media mentions, website traffic, and search volume), engagement rate (measured through likes, shares, comments, and click-through rates), conversion rate (measured through leads generated, sales made, and revenue earned), and customer lifetime value (measured through repeat purchases and customer loyalty). Regularly monitoring these KPIs will allow you to identify areas for improvement and optimize your narrative strategy for maximum impact. A/B testing different narratives and messaging is also a valuable technique for determining what resonates most with your audience.

Beyond Sales: Building Long-Term Brand Equity

While driving sales is undoubtedly important, a well-crafted narrative can contribute to something far more valuable: long-term brand equity. Brand equity represents the intangible value associated with your brand – the perceptions, beliefs, and associations that customers have about it. A strong narrative can help to build brand equity by creating a positive emotional connection with your audience, differentiating your brand from competitors, and fostering a sense of trust and loyalty. This is where understanding the deeper implications of approaches like vincispin becomes essential. Consider Patagonia, a brand known for its commitment to environmental sustainability. Their narratives consistently focus on protecting the planet, which resonates deeply with their target audience and has helped to build a strong and enduring brand equity. This commitment, woven into every aspect of their business, elevates them beyond a mere clothing retailer to a symbol of responsible consumption.
